RELATEED CONSULTING
相关咨询
欢迎选择下列在线客服咨询
微信客服
微信客服二维码
热线电话:13863516421
7x24小时,全年无休
我们服务器的承诺:
关闭右侧工具栏

香港服务器专题

香港服务器租用高并发下数据库锁机制优化

  • 来源:本站
  • 编辑: admin
  • 时间:2025-05-23 09:18:54
  • 阅读233次

标题:香港服务器租用高并发下数据库锁机制优化

香港服务器租用在高并发环境下,数据库锁机制的优化显得尤为重要。合理的数据库锁机制能够提升系统的响应速度和数据一致性,同时避免因锁导致的性能瓶颈。本文将从优化数据库锁机制入手,分析香港服务器租用环境下的高并发问题,提出相应的解决方案。

一、引言

在高并发环境下,数据库的访问量剧增,服务器的压力也随之增大,数据库的锁机制也变得尤为重要。如果数据库锁机制设计不当,可能会导致数据库性能下降,甚至出现死锁现象,严重时甚至会引发整个系统的崩溃。因此,对于香港服务器租用的用户而言,优化数据库锁机制是提升系统性能的重要手段。

二、高并发环境下的数据库锁机制挑战

高并发环境下,数据库的锁机制面临着诸多挑战。例如,锁的争用问题,如果并发访问量过大,数据库锁的获取和释放过程可能会变得非常耗时,导致系统响应速度变慢。此外,锁的死锁问题也常常出现,当多个事务之间存在循环等待锁的情况时,可能会导致系统无法继续运行。再者,锁的粒度问题也是高并发环境下数据库锁机制需要关注的,如果锁的粒度过大,可能会导致不必要的锁竞争;而锁的粒度过小,则可能会导致锁的持有时间过长,从而影响系统的性能。

三、数据库锁机制优化策略

针对高并发环境下数据库锁机制的挑战,我们提出以下几种优化策略。

  1. 分布式锁机制:在高并发环境下,可以考虑采用分布式锁机制,通过分布式系统中的多个节点来共同管理锁的获取和释放,从而避免了单点故障和锁竞争的问题。分布式锁机制通常采用的实现方式有Redis分布式锁、Zookeeper分布式锁等。

  2. 读写分离:读写分离是一种常见的数据库优化策略,通过将读请求和写请求分别交给不同的数据库实例处理,可以有效降低数据库的并发压力。在高并发环境下,可以考虑采用读写分离的策略,将热点数据和频繁查询的数据存储在读取速度更快的数据库实例中,从而提高系统的响应速度。

  3. 数据库事务优化:数据库事务的优化也是提高系统性能的重要手段。例如,可以采用短事务策略,减少事务的执行时间;同时,也可以考虑使用数据库事务的隔离级别来控制并发事务的数量,从而避免锁竞争和死锁现象的发生。

四、结论

数据库锁机制在高并发环境下扮演着至关重要的角色。香港服务器租用用户在使用数据库时,需要充分考虑锁机制的优化问题,通过采用分布式锁机制、读写分离等策略,可以有效提升系统的性能和稳定性。此外,数据库事务的优化也是提高系统性能的重要手段,用户可以采用短事务策略和控制事务隔离级别等方法,来避免锁竞争和死锁现象的发生。

我们提供7X24小时售后服务,了解更多机房产品和服务,敬请联系
购买咨询 售后服务